Summary

Fifth Third Bancorp (FITB) filed this Form 8-K on January 21, 2010, to announce its financial results for the fourth quarter of 2009. The filing includes a press release and detailed financial supplements that provide insight into the company's performance and financial condition during the period. Investors should note that this report primarily serves to furnish previously released information regarding earnings and related financial data. The accompanying exhibits offer a deeper dive into credit trends and the company's loan and lease portfolio, which are crucial for understanding the bank's asset quality and risk exposure, especially in the prevailing economic environment of early 2010.
